Essential RTX 5090 Settings to Optimise Minecraft Performance

The RTX 5090 boasts exceptional ray tracing and AI capabilities, but these features can be demanding. Start by adjusting Minecraft’s video settings: reduce unnecessary fancy effects like clouds or vignette, and set the render distance to a balanced level (12-16 chunks is ideal). Leveraging the card’s DLSS tech boosts framerates significantly without losing visual clarity.

Master Your RTX 5090 with Driver and System Optimisations 🔧

Keeping your RTX 5090 drivers up to date is non-negotiable — NVIDIA regularly rolls out drivers optimised for new games and performance fixes. Use NVIDIA GeForce Experience to enable automatic updates. Next, fine-tune your PC’s power settings: set to “Maximum Performance” under the power management tab in the NVIDIA Control Panel to avoid throttling during intense Minecraft sessions.

Boost Performance with Custom Fan Curves

Adjust your RTX 5090’s fan curve in MSI Afterburner to ramp up cooling only when temperatures hit 65°C. This way, you keep noise low during casual play but prevent overheating when the action heats up.

Overclocking RTX 5090 for Minecraft: What You Should Know

Overclocking can offer a solid performance uptick. Nvidia’s RTX 5090 handles mild overclocking well, but stability varies by system. Increase core clock and memory clock speeds in small 10-20 MHz increments, then stress test with Minecraft’s built-in benchmark or third-party tools.

Make the Most of Minecraft Mods and RTX Features 🚀

Minecraft’s RTX mode shows off real-time ray tracing that makes reflections, shadows, and water look superb. Yet this is GPU-intensive. Use Minecraft’s settings to toggle individual ray-tracing features for the best FPS-to-quality ratio. Also, aim for compatible mods designed for RTX optimisation.
